Latest Project

Faceland Digital Rebrand - Creating a Unified Design Language Across All Channels

I developed a new design language to unify the brand’s digital touchpoints. The goal was to align the online experience with the high-quality clinical care customers receive in person, ensuring visual consistency and brand authority across all digital channels.

A mobile first homepage that guides every visitor toward real value

A complete overhaul of the primary entry point to solve navigation friction. By implementing mobile-first design principles, I improved the visual flow and ensured that key services are easily discoverable for the majority of the user base.

A Refined Deals Experience That Balances Clarity and User Insight

I replaced cluttered marketing banners with a stable, Gestalt-driven card system to fix the visual inconsistency. By cutting the "marketing noise" and prioritizing price contrast, I turned a messy discount page into a high-trust, mobile-first experience that actually drives conversion.

How Can We Leverage Laws From Cognitive Psychology?

How Can We Leverage Laws From Cognitive Psychology?

Laws from cognitive psychology help us design experiences that align with how people naturally think, perceive, and make decisions. By reducing cognitive load, guiding attention through visual hierarchy, and respecting human limitations like memory and reaction time, interfaces become easier to understand and use. Principles such as Gestalt grouping, Hick’s Law, and Fitts’s Law allow designers to simplify choices, improve clarity, and make interactions feel predictable. When applied intentionally, these laws turn abstract theory into practical design decisions that support confidence, reduce friction, and help users move through experiences with minimal effort and hesitation.

Cognitive Overload

The tendency for people to get overwhelmed when they are presented with a large number of options, often used interchangeably with the term paradox of choice.

When the amount of information coming in exceeds the space we have available, we struggle mentally to keep up — tasks become more difficult, details are missed, and we begin to feel overwhelmed.

Peak-End Rule

People judge an experience largely based on how they felt at its peak and at its end, rather than the total sum or average of every moment of the experience.

"Pay close attention to the most intense points and the final moments (the “end”) of the user journey."

Von Restorff Effect

The Von Restorff effect, also known as The Isolation Effect, predicts that when multiple similar objects are present, the one that differs from the rest is most likely to be remembered.

"Make important information or key actions visually distinctive."
